Toto Cup Ligat Al is a domestic football cup competition in Israel, distinct from the country’s top-flight league, Ligat Ha’Al. It forms part of the Israeli football calendar and provides clubs with an additional competitive route alongside league football.
Competition identity and role
As a cup tournament, Toto Cup Ligat Al is defined by its knockout identity rather than by a season-long league table. Its purpose is to determine a cup winner through progression between rounds, giving participating clubs the opportunity to compete for silverware outside the regular league championship. The competition also adds meaningful fixtures to the Israeli domestic programme and can provide competitive preparation during the opening part of the season.
The tournament should not be confused with Ligat Ha’Al, the Israeli Premier League. Ligat Ha’Al is the country’s highest league division and decides the national league champion through a points-based campaign. Toto Cup Ligat Al is a separate cup competition, with its own results, fixtures and winner.
